c#去掉小數點后的無效0 decimal d = 0.0500m;d.ToString("0.##")就出來了也可以這樣 string.Format("{0:0.##}",d).##表示最多保留2位有效數字,但是不包括0,就是說 如果上面d=0.5000,出來后也只是0.5 ...
c#去掉小數點后的無效0 decimal d = 0.0500m;d.ToString("0.##")就出來了也可以這樣 string.Format("{0:0.##}",d).##表示最多保留2位有效數字,但是不包括0,就是說 如果上面d=0.5000,出來后也只是0.5 ...
原文地址:https://www.cnblogs.com/kingreatwill/p/7761084.html#/cnblog/works/article/7761084 c#去掉小數點后的無效0 decimal d = 0.0500m;d.ToString("0.##")就出來 ...
1.保留2位有效數字 decimal d = 0.0500m; d.ToString("0.##")就出來了 也可以這樣 string.Format("{0:0.##}",d) .##表示最多保留2位有效數字,但是不包括0,就是說 如果上面d=0.5000,出來后也只是0.5 2.保留8位 ...
最近經常碰到需要去除double類型的小數點之后的0的需求,每次都需要去查找,挺麻煩的。 這邊暫時有一個簡單粗暴的方法,也就記一下,自己親自測試成功: ...
...
https://zhidao.baidu.com/question/537686608.html 1、num.ToString("#0.00"); //點后面幾個0就保留幾位 2、num.ToSt ...
數據庫中存放BigDecimal類型的數據,如果存放4或者4.1的話,在數據庫中會存放4.0000和4.1000,此時在前台顯示會不合適,故需要去除.和0,方法如下: 參數是BigDecimal的toString()。 public BigDecimal getPrettyNumber ...
需求: 針對帶有小數點的數字信息,去除小數點后多余的零 可能存在的情況: 1、精度范圍內,出現多余的零 eg:1234.3400 想要的結果為1234.34 2、精度變大出現的多余的零,或者沒有實際小數部分的數據 eg:1234.0 ...